Vibecotamab for measurable residual disease in acute myeloid leukemia and for myelodysplastic syndromes and chronic myelomonocytic leukemia after hypomethylating agent failure: a phase II study. (PubMed, J Hematol Oncol)
Vibecotamab was active in low-blast myeloid diseases, although the durability of responses was modest. Additional studies of CD123-targeting bispecific antibodies, alone or in combination, are warranted for these diseases.

A Nomogram Prediction Model and Scoring System for Resistance in Acute Myeloid Leukemia Patients Treated with Venetoclax Combined with Hypomethylating Agents. (PubMed, Curr Oncol)
KIT, TP53, and FAB-M5 are independent factors influencing VEN resistance. The constructed nomogram prediction model and scoring system may provide valuable references for predicting primary resistance to VEN.

Initial leukemic epigenomic state determines hypomethylating agent response. (PubMed, Nat Commun)
Hypomethylation and chromatin accessibility at ZNF143- and CTCF-binding sites results in activation of HOXB4, which defines the HSC/MPP-like state and HMA-sensitivity. Our study provides evidence that the epigenomic state of the LSC is a major determinant of response to HMAs, and demonstrates that a routine clinical assay can identify patients who will respond.
